Your role: The Client Services Coordinator delivers exceptional client service and supports practice operations by managing reception, communications, meetings, client deliverables, and office readiness while ensuring work is handled accurately, securely, professionally, and in line with firm quality and compliance standards.
Communication & Client Service
Manage the reception area including answering and directing incoming calls, greeting clients.
Screen and redirect client enquiries, gauge urgency, and elevate as required.
Coordinate secure client communications, information requests, document exchanges, year-end letters, legal letters, and other engagement-related correspondence with clients and authorized third parties while maintaining confidentiality requirements.
Meetings & Facilities Coordination
Ensure boardroom, reception and common areas are tidy and presentable with all necessary stationary, forms, and supplies available.
Coordinate meeting logistics including scheduling, room bookings, calendar management, and virtual meeting setup
Manage and order office supplies.




Assist with building maintenance and operational issues.
Support daily office operations including workspace readiness, facility coordination, and office opening and closing procedures
Manage courier services, outgoing mail, inter-office transfers, and document delivery tracking.
Payments& General Administration
Perform daily accounts receivable functions including cheque and cash deposits, debit/credit card transactions and communication with clients regarding their account balance.
Other general administrative duties as required including filing, photocopying, scanning, and faxing.
Document Management & Workflow
Prepare, review, distribute, and track client-facing documents and engagement correspondence, ensuring they meet firm quality and document standards.
Maintain electronic records through document retention, archiving, retrieval, resolution management, and lockdown processes
Coordinate client document intake, job setup, and workflow routing to support tax and assurance engagement processes
Log, track, and maintain client documents and workflow information within firm systems including iFirm, CaseWare, TaxPrep, ShareFile, and document management platforms.
Prepare, distribute, review, and archive legal correspondence and annual resolutions.
Professionalism & Ethics
Uphold ethical standards and exercise sound professional judgment.
Collaborate effectively with team members and support a positive work environment.
Technical Skills
Expected to work effectively with firm-approved tools and platforms, which may include Office 365 applications, iFirm TaxPrep, CaseWare, Adobe eSign, and iFirm Client Portal, and to follow cybersecurity and secure data handling protocols.
What you bring to the table: Post-secondary diploma or degree.




Administrative or client service experience; skilled services experience is an asset.
Strong technical skills and a willingness to learn new systems; prior experience with specific software is not required.
Strong organization, time management, communication, and attention to detail.
Sound judgment, discretion, and professionalism when handling sensitive information.
Adaptable, dependable, and able to work independently and collaboratively.

Where you’ll work: We are currently hiring for our offices in Guelph, Ontario.
Job Type: Permanent, Full-time
100% in-office
Salary range: $50,000 - $55,000 per annum.
Monday to Friday, 8:30am to 5:00pm and Saturdays in April from 9:00am-1:00pm
Standard hours are 7.5 hours per day. Hours increase during peak season, January to April.
